Karoo National Park, South Africa
Karoo National Park, in South Africa's Western Cape region, is a one-of-a-kind and fascinating site that allows tourists to enjoy the rugged beauty of the semi-desert Karoo.
The park is home to a diverse range of animals, including antelopes, springboks, and several bird species, making it a popular destination for wildlife and environment enthusiasts.
Table Mountain NP
Table Mountain National Park is located in Cape Town, South Africa. The National Park includes two major landmarks, Table Mountain and the Cape of Good Hope.
Kgalagadi Transfrontier National Park, Southern Africa
Kgalagadi Transfrontier Park, located in the Kalahari Desert, is a vast wildlife reserve that straddles the border between South Africa and Botswana.
Addo Elephant National Park, South Africa
Addo Elephant National Park is a wildlife reserve located in the Eastern Cape province of South Africa.
With its diverse landscapes, including bushlands, forests, and savanna grasslands, this park is home to a rich array of wildlife, including elephants, lions, buffalos, and many more.
Kruger National Park, South Africa
Kruger National Park is located in Northeastern South Africa. Kruger is one of the largest game parks in the whole of Africa - and covers an area of close to 19,500 square kilometres.
Marakele NP
Marakele National Park is a true gem located in the heart of South Africa's Waterberg region. This breathtaking park is home to an incredible array of wildlife, including the lion, leopard, elephant, buffalo, and hyena, as well as over 300 bird species.
The park is also home to the Tswana people, who have lived in harmony with the land for centuries.
